SecurityRuleInner Construtores
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Sobrecargas
SecurityRuleInner() |
Inicializa uma nova instância da classe SecurityRuleInner. |
SecurityRuleInner(SecurityRuleProtocol, SecurityRuleAccess, SecurityRuleDirection, String, String, String, String, String, IList<String>, IList<ApplicationSecurityGroupInner>, String, IList<String>, IList<ApplicationSecurityGroupInner>, IList<String>, IList<String>, Nullable<Int32>, ProvisioningState, String, String) |
Inicializa uma nova instância da classe SecurityRuleInner. |
SecurityRuleInner()
Inicializa uma nova instância da classe SecurityRuleInner.
public SecurityRuleInner ();
Public Sub New ()
Aplica-se a
SecurityRuleInner(SecurityRuleProtocol, SecurityRuleAccess, SecurityRuleDirection, String, String, String, String, String, IList<String>, IList<ApplicationSecurityGroupInner>, String, IList<String>, IList<ApplicationSecurityGroupInner>, IList<String>, IList<String>, Nullable<Int32>, ProvisioningState, String, String)
Inicializa uma nova instância da classe SecurityRuleInner.
public SecurityRuleInner (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leProtocol protocol,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leAccess access,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leDirection direction, string id = default, string description = default, string sourcePortRange = default, string destinationPortRange = default, string sourceAddressPrefix = default, System.Collections.Generic.IList<string> sourceAddressPrefixes = default, System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Fluent.Models.ApplicationSecurityGroupInner> sourceApplicationSecurityGroups = default, string destinationAddressPrefix = default, System.Collections.Generic.IList<string> destinationAddressPrefixes = default, System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Fluent.Models.ApplicationSecurityGroupInner> destinationApplicationSecurityGroups = default, System.Collections.Generic.IList<string> sourcePortRanges = default, System.Collections.Generic.IList<string> destinationPortRanges = default, int? priority = default, Microsoft.Azure.Management.Network.Fluent.Models.ProvisioningState provisioningState = default, string name = default, string etag = default);
new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leInner :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leProtocol *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leAccess *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leDirection * string * string * string * string * string * System.Collections.Generic.IList<string> * System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Fluent.Models.ApplicationSecurityGroupInner> * string * System.Collections.Generic.IList<string> * System.Collections.Generic.IList<Microsoft.Azure.Management.Network.Fluent.Models.ApplicationSecurityGroupInner> * System.Collections.Generic.IList<string> * System.Collections.Generic.IList<string> * Nullable<int> * Microsoft.Azure.Management.Network.Fluent.Models.ProvisioningState * string * string -> Microsoft.Azure.Management.Network.Fluent.Models.SecurityRuleInner
Public Sub New (protocol As SecurityRuleProtocol, access As SecurityRuleAccess, direction As SecurityRuleDirection, Optional id As String = Nothing, Optional description As String = Nothing, Optional sourcePortRange As String = Nothing, Optional destinationPortRange As String = Nothing, Optional sourceAddressPrefix As String = Nothing, Optional sourceAddressPrefixes As IList(Of String) = Nothing, Optional sourceApplicationSecurityGroups As IList(Of ApplicationSecurityGroupInner) = Nothing, Optional destinationAddressPrefix As String = Nothing, Optional destinationAddressPrefixes As IList(Of String) = Nothing, Optional destinationApplicationSecurityGroups As IList(Of ApplicationSecurityGroupInner) = Nothing, Optional sourcePortRanges As IList(Of String) = Nothing, Optional destinationPortRanges As IList(Of String) = Nothing, Optional priority As Nullable(Of Integer) = Nothing, Optional provisioningState As ProvisioningState = Nothing, Optional name As String = Nothing, Optional etag As String = Nothing)
Parâmetros
- protocol
- SecurityRuleProtocol
O protocolo de rede a que essa regra se aplica. Os valores possíveis incluem: 'Tcp', 'Udp', 'Icmp', 'Esp', '*', 'Ah'
- access
- SecurityRuleAccess
O tráfego de rede é permitido ou negado. Os valores possíveis incluem: 'Allow', 'Deny'
- direction
- SecurityRuleDirection
A direção da regra. A direção especifica se a regra é avaliada no tráfego de entrada ou saída. Os valores possíveis incluem: 'Inbound', 'Outbound'
- id
- String
- description
- String
Uma descrição dessa regra. Restrito a 140 caracteres.
- sourcePortRange
- String
A porta de origem ou o intervalo. Inteiro ou intervalo entre 0 e 65535. O asterisco '*' também pode ser usado para corresponder a todas as portas.
- destinationPortRange
- String
A porta ou o intervalo de destino. Inteiro ou intervalo entre 0 e 65535. O asterisco '*' também pode ser usado para corresponder a todas as portas.
- sourceAddressPrefix
- String
O intervalo CIDR ou IP de origem. O asterisco "*" também pode ser usado para corresponder a todos os IPs de origem. Marcas padrão como 'VirtualNetwork', 'AzureLoadBalancer' e 'Internet' também podem ser usadas. Se essa for uma regra de entrada, especifica de onde o tráfego de rede se origina.
- sourceApplicationSecurityGroups
- IList<ApplicationSecurityGroupInner>
O grupo de segurança do aplicativo especificado como origem.
- destinationAddressPrefix
- String
O prefixo de endereço de destino. CIDR ou intervalo de IP de destino. O asterisco "*" também pode ser usado para corresponder a todos os IPs de origem. Marcas padrão como 'VirtualNetwork', 'AzureLoadBalancer' e 'Internet' também podem ser usadas.
Os prefixos de endereço de destino. Intervalos de IP de destino ou CIDR.
- destinationApplicationSecurityGroups
- IList<ApplicationSecurityGroupInner>
O grupo de segurança do aplicativo especificado como destino.
A prioridade da regra. O valor pode estar entre 100 e 4096. O número da prioridade deve ser exclusivo para cada regra na coleção. Quanto menor o número da prioridade, maior será a prioridade da regra.
- provisioningState
- ProvisioningState
O estado de provisionamento do recurso de regra de segurança. Os valores possíveis incluem: 'Êxito', 'Atualizando', 'Excluindo', 'Falha'
- name
- String
O nome do recurso que é exclusivo em um grupo de recursos. Esse nome pode ser usado para acessar o recurso.
- etag
- String
Uma cadeia de caracteres somente leitura exclusiva que é alterada sempre que o recurso é atualizado.
Aplica-se a
Azure SDK for .NET